Many people make the mistake of thinking they will get noticed, get ahead even, by speaking as much as possible, by offering opinions, sharing (showing off) knowledge or making suggestions. When we look at developing our own or our colleagues’ communication skills we should consider not only focusing on voice projection, intonation, and choice of language but also on how we can incorporate the use of silence into our communication toolkit. Perhaps we need to focus as much on what we don’t as what we do say. Below are some key situations where using silence can help you to become more effective.

Feeling stressed can feel perfectly normal.

Bad Stress vs. Good Stress: Do you Know the Difference

You might notice that sometimes being stressed-out motivates you to focus on your work, yet at other times, you feel incredibly overwhelmed and can’t concentrate on anything. While stress affects everyone in different ways, there are two major types of stress: stress that’s beneficial and motivating — good stress — and stress or Benefit of Stress that causes anxiety and even health problems — bad stress. Here’s more on the benefits and side effects of stress and how to tell if you’re experiencing too much stress. According to experts, stress is a burst of energy that basically advises you on what to do.

In small doses, stress has many advantages. Stress is also a vital warning system, producing a fight-or-flight response. In addition, there are various health benefits with a little bit of stress. Strategic Thinking Recently, I was approached by a manager and asked a question I hear a lot, “Why would we need a strategic retreat for anyone below the senior management level?”

Why Strategic Retreats Are For Everyone? - bethebestyoucanbe

My answer was very simple: “A strategic retreat provides a designated time for team members to take a step back from normal activities, call ‘time out’ from putting out fires and responding to crisis, and take a focused look at the team’s direction. This effort includes a check on progress for existing strategic projects and a review of accountability, commitments, and future. A retreat also creates an opportunity to reassess the team’s fundamental direction, vision, and competitiveness.

This doesn’t just apply to the business executives.
